Transaction 22ad4d2e192d34c59ecc506642fc592006ae723da9106cb12a88ec16261ee867

1 Input
2 Outputs
  • 22ad4d2e192d34c59ecc506642fc592006ae723da9106cb12a88ec16261ee867:0
  • value  1917481
    address  38PcHruA5aPbTt9shjxEcTLVRkmRUdMMHt
  • 22ad4d2e192d34c59ecc506642fc592006ae723da9106cb12a88ec16261ee867:1
  • value  50378
    address  17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c